As a Formulation Scientist at Boots, you will play a pivotal role in shaping the future of our product offerings by leveraging your scientific and technical expertise to develop high-quality, compliant products that meet consumer needs.

Key Responsibilities

  • Support the development of new consumer healthcare and beauty formulations from concept to market, ensuring delivery to agreed time, cost and quality standards.
  • Apply in-depth knowledge of formulation technologies, regulatory requirements, medicinal legislation and technical IP.
  • Manage and coordinate formulation projects with a high degree of autonomy, identifying and mitigating technical and delivery risks.
  • Work closely with internal stakeholders and external partners, including third-party manufacturers and co-developers, to ensure successful scale-up and manufacture.
  • Operate confidently within a factory and manufacturing environment, maintaining strong attention to detail and quality.
  • Contribute to the wider Boots Product Brand strategy by developing beauty and healthcare formulations that meet consumer needs and commercial objectives.

What You'll Need to Have (Our Must-Haves)

  • Degree in Science or Technology, with 3+ years' formulation experience ideally with beauty or healthcare, including licensed medicines.
  • Strong expertise in health and or beauty formulations, with a demonstrable track record of delivering products from concept to market.
  • Excellent knowledge of multiple formulation technologies and a solid understanding of the end-to-end value chain and manufacturing processes.
  • Proven ability to manage complex formulation development projects, influence stakeholders and work effectively across functions.
  • Highly organised, risk-aware and detail-focused, with the confidence to work autonomously in a fast-paced environment.
  • Passionate about formulation science and motivated to make a meaningful contribution to the future success of the Boots brand.

It Would Be Great If You Also Have

  • Experience in project management and cross-functional collaboration.
  • Familiarity with consumer insights and market trends in health and beauty.
